Q:What kind of piercing would you recommend a scaffold piercing in the ears cartlidge or a belly button piercing?
I have both my cartilage and my belly button pierced. I love them both! Cartilage piercing was initially less painful until you had to turn it once a day during cleaning - that hurt a lot. Also, whichever side you get it pierced on - it will hurt SO bad if you sleep on that side. It takes around 8 months to a year to completely heal. Cost was $40. Belly button - It felt like a pinch when I got mine done. Clean this one 2x a day with sea salt soaks. Don't swim until it is completely healed. It takes 6-8 months to completely heal. Cost was $20 on half price piercing day - so it's usually $40.

Q:An 800N painter stands 3.00m from the left end of a scaffold that is 4.00m long. The uniform wooden scaffold weighs 100N and is hung by a chain at each end. What is the tension in each chain?A uniform meter stick weighs 25 N. An 80 N weight is hung at the 20.0cm mark. A 70.0N weight is hung at the 90cm mark. what is the magnitude of the upward force needed to balance the meter stick?Please help! I have a huge exam on these and my teacher wouldn't help me! I am so stumped please help!
Required conditions for equilibrium (Other wise the scaffold is moving) Sum of forces = 0 Sum of Torques = 0 Sum of Forces Painter: 800 N DOWN Scaffold: 100 N Down Sum of tensions in chains = 800 + 100 = 900 N UP Sum of Torques (Pick one end, it does not matter which. I choose the Left end) Torque = Force * Lever arm Painter is 3.0 meters from Left end Tp = 800 N * 3.00 m = 2,400 N-m CW (Clockwise) Center of gravity is at the center of the scaffold or 4/2 = 2 meters from the Left enf Ts = 100 * 2 = 200 N-m CW This means that the chain on the Right end must supply 2400 + 200 = 2600 N-m CCW Tc = Fc * 4.00 m 2600 = Fc * 4 Fc= 650 N UP Total need up is 900 N====> 900 - 650 = 250 N in Left chain QED
